Especificações
| Atributo | Valor |
| Part Status | Active |
| Type | ADC, DAC |
| Number of Channels | 32 |
| Resolution (Bits) | 12 b |
| Voltage Supply Source | Single Supply |
| Voltage - Supply | 1.65V ~ 5.5V, 1.65V ~ 5.5V |
| Operating Temperature | -40°C ~ 125°C |
| Mounting Type | Surface Mount |
| Package / Case | 48-PowerTQFP |
| Supplier Device Package | 48-HTQFP (7x7) |
